Mr. Bartlett practiced in the areas of water law and related environmental litigation in Colorado for eight years. Upon returning to Florida, he has continued his emphasis in the areas of water law, environmental law, property rights, eminent domain and general real estate matters. Mr. Bartlett has represented land owners, developers, and governmental entities in the development and protection of water supply and delivery systems, environmental permitting and defense of various agency enforcement matters against local, state, and federal agencies. He has also represented owners of wastewater treatment plants in permitting and enforcement actions. Mr. Bartlett's background in environmental litigation is a benefit in his eminent domain practice, where environmental issues are frequently encountered and expensive to resolve.
